  • Clara Harris, The Woman Who Ran Over and Killed Her Husband
    Aug 10 2021
    From April 28, 2005: Oprah talks with Clara Harris, a woman who ran over and killed her husband with her Mercedes-Benz several times after confronting him and his mistress at a suburban Houston hotel. Harris was convicted of murder in February 2003 and was released in 2018. Oprah hears her side of the story from the Mountain View Correctional Center. We hear the story she wasn't allowed to tell in the courtroom.

  • Burned Alive By a Drunk Driver (Jacqueline Saburido)
    Jul 20 2021
    From November 25, 2003: Oprah sits down with Jacqueline Saburido, a young woman who was burned alive by a drunk driver and lived to tell the story. Jacqui passed away in 2019. We then hear the story of a man who forgetfully left his baby in his car alone for three hours to discover he passed away due to heat stroke. We learn how our momentary mistakes can lead to devastating consequences.
